Jakob Stoklund Olesen
0deaa616a3 Record identity assignments in regalloc constraint solver.
Fixes #147.

The Solver::reassign_in() method would previously not record fixed
register assignments for values that are already in the correct
register. The register would simply be marked as unavailable for the
solver.

This did have the effect of tripping up the sanity checks in
Solver::add_var() when that method was called with such a "reassigned"
value. The function can be called for a value that already has a fixed
assignment, but the sanity checks want to make sure the variable
constraints are compatible with the existing fixed assignment. When no
such assignment could be found, the method panicked.

To fix this, make sure that even identity reassignments are recorded
in the assignments vector. Instead, filter the identity assignments out
before scheduling a move sequence for the assignments.

Also add some debug tracing to the regalloc solver.

Jakob Stoklund Olesen
7e08b14cf6 Split EntityMap into entity::PrimaryMap and entity::EntityMap.
The new PrimaryMap replaces the primary EntityMap and the PrimaryEntityData
marker trait which was causing some confusion. We now have a clear
division between the two types of maps:

- PrimaryMap is used to assign entity numbers to the primary data for an
  entity.
- EntityMap is a secondary mapping adding additional info.

The split also means that the secondary EntityMap can now behave as if
all keys have a default value. This means that we can get rid of the
annoying ensure() and get_or_default() methods ther were used everywhere
instead of indexing. Just use normal indexing now; non-existent keys
will return the default value.

Jakob Stoklund Olesen
c96d4daa20 Add a calling convention to all function signatures.
A CallConv enum on every function signature makes it possible to
generate calls to functions with different calling conventions within
the same ISA / within a single function.

The calling conventions also serve as a way of customizing Cretonne's
behavior when embedded inside a VM. As an example, the SpiderWASM
calling convention is used to compile WebAssembly functions that run
inside the SpiderMonkey virtual machine.

All function signatures must have a calling convention at the end, so
this changes the textual IL syntax.

Before:

    sig1 = signature(i32, f64) -> f64

After

    sig1 = (i32, f64) -> f64 native
    sig2 = (i32) spiderwasm

When printing functions, the signature goes after the return types:

    function %r1() -> i32, f32 spiderwasm {
    ebb1:
        ...
    }

In the parser, this calling convention is optional and defaults to
"native". This is mostly to avoid updating all the existing test cases
under filetests/. When printing a function, the calling convention is
always included, including for "native" functions.

Jakob Stoklund Olesen
f03f32ac93 Assign call arguments to stack slots.
When making an outgoing call, some arguments may have to be passed on
the stack. Allocate OutgoingArg stack slots for these arguments and
write them immediately before the outgoing call instruction.

Do the same for incoming function arguments on the stack, but use
IncomingArg stack slots instead. This was previously done in the
spiller, but we move it to the legalizer so it is done at the same time
as outgoing stack arguments.

These stack slot assignments are done in the legalizer before live
range analysis because the outgoing arguments usually are in different
SSSA values with their own short live ranges.
